NOAA Weather Radio All Hazards Coverage Across Southeast Lower Michigan

This table provides information on where to tune for NOAA Weather Radio All Hazards coverage for the counties of Southeast Lower Michigan. Where multiple transmitters are listed for a county, you should test your reception of each listed frequency and set your Weather Radio to the strongest signal.

NOAA Weather Radio All Hazard broadcasts for this area originate from the NOAA's National Weather Service forecast office in Detroit Michigan.
